Contractors Overview

Contractors specializing in cinder block wall repair typically handle a range of services aimed at restoring structural integrity and improving appearance. This work often includes assessing existing damage, such as cracks, bulges, or deterioration caused by moisture or age, and then performing necessary repairs. Tasks may involve removing damaged blocks, reinforcing the wall’s foundation, applying new mortar, and replacing or re-sealing blocks to ensure stability. In some cases, repair work also extends to addressing issues like water infiltration or drainage problems that can contribute to further damage if left unaddressed.
